Nettet25. mar. 2024 · Trimming Shafts to Improve Accuracy: Cut from Grip End. "If the goal in making the clubs shorter in length is a desire to gain an improvement in accuracy, the reduction in length should be made from the grip end only," Wishon said. Nettet6. mar. 2024 · If you swing the driver at 95-110 mph you should be using a stiff shaft. When swinging at that speed that stiff flex will give you the optimum spin, launch, direction and speed. What Swing Speed Should Use X Stiff Flex. The x stiff shaft is for the super fast swing speeds, anything over 110 mph and you should be using an x stiff shaft.
